Futures for the three major U.S. stock indices extended their losses, with Nasdaq 100 futures falling more than 1%.
Svmuu News: According to data from MSX.COM, futures for the three major U.S. stock indices extended their losses, with Nasdaq 100 futures down more than 1%, S&P 500 futures down 0.73%, and Dow Jones futures down 0.83%.
